Output 259bef67d4a29b8673d593a36cffa78b4135e29175786efbcb1ff6e37836167f:3

value
630897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f4f52d94b9884e7a44365296b773a7a151aa31 OP_EQUAL
address
3EGTwnXYC5X4iYwxKyWucZBrt6m2zsZbMZ
transaction
259bef67d4a29b8673d593a36cffa78b4135e29175786efbcb1ff6e37836167f
spent
true